Combat strategy for beginners

Winning more consistently in Air Strike Warfare 2017 usually comes down to staying controlled in the air. Fast games can make it tempting to rush, but that often leads to mistakes.

Beginner combat tips

  • Focus on survival first
  • Attack when enemies are in a predictable path
  • Avoid flying in straight lines for too long
  • Reposition after each attack if you can
  • Watch the entire screen, not just the center

Common mistakes to avoid

New players often lose momentum because they focus too much on attacking and not enough on flight control.

Avoid these habits:

  • flying straight into enemy fire
  • overcommitting to one target
  • ignoring threats behind you
  • making sudden movement changes that throw off your aim
  • staying in one area too long

A calmer, more controlled approach usually works better than trying to force every shot.
